Linux下用命令查看CPU ID
时间: 2023-07-23 19:28:03 浏览: 185
您可以使用以下命令查看Linux系统下的CPU ID:
```
cat /proc/cpuinfo | grep "cpu cores\|vendor_id\|model name\|model\|stepping\|cpu MHz\|cache size\|physical id\|siblings\|flags" | uniq
```
这个命令会输出您系统中CPU的相关信息,包括厂商ID、型号、主频、缓存大小等。您可以在输出结果中找到CPU ID的相关信息。
相关问题
linux查看linux 命令 查看磁盘 查看进程 查看线程 CPU 占用量 linux 命令 查看磁盘 查看进程 查看线程 CPU 占用量 linux查看进程 查看线程 CPU 占用量
你可以使用以下命令来查看磁盘使用情况:
1. 查看磁盘空间:`df -h`
这会显示磁盘分区的使用情况,包括已使用空间、可用空间和文件系统类型。
2. 查看指定目录的磁盘使用情况:`du -sh <目录路径>`
这会显示指定目录的总大小。
要查看进程信息,可以使用以下命令:
1. 查看所有进程:`ps aux`
这会显示所有正在运行的进程的详细信息。
2. 查找特定进程:`ps aux | grep <进程名>`
这会根据进程名过滤并显示相关进程的信息。
要查看线程信息,可以使用以下命令:
1. 查看进程的线程信息:`ps -T <进程ID>`
这会显示指定进程的线程信息。
要查看 CPU 占用量,可以使用以下命令:
1. 查看 CPU 占用量统计:`top`
这会实时显示 CPU 占用量最高的进程和线程。
2. 查看 CPU 占用量统计(按 CPU 使用率排序):`top -o %CPU`
这会按照 CPU 使用率从高到低的顺序显示进程和线程。
记住,这些命令在不同的 Linux 发行版中可能会有细微差别,所以请根据你使用的发行版进行适当的调整。
Linux下命令行如何查看CPU资源
在Linux的命令行环境下,你可以使用`top`、`htop` 或 `mpstat` 等工具来监控CPU资源。以下是几个常用的命令:
1. **top**:实时查看系统运行状况,包括CPU、内存、进程等信息。按`Shift + P` 可以按照CPU占用率排序。
```
top - 16:47:59 up 5 days, 2:08, 3 users, load average: 0.07, 0.12, 0.16
Tasks: 271 total, 1 running, 270 sleeping, 0 stopped, 0 zombie
%Cpu(s): 0.9 us, 0.6 sy, 0.0 ni, 98.4 id, 0.1 wa, 0.0 hi, 0.0 si, 0.0 st
Mem: 16G total, 12G used, 4G free, 1G buffers, 3G cached
... (更多信息)
```
2. **htop**:类似于`top`,但是提供了更为直观的界面和更多的交互功能。
3. **mpstat**:用于收集处理器性能统计信息。默认情况下会显示每个CPU核心的使用情况。
```
mpstat 1 5
```
其中第一个数字指定报告间隔(秒),第二个数字表示报告周期数。
通过以上命令,你可以看到CPU的使用百分比、空闲时间、上下文切换次数等重要指标。如果你想查看特定进程的CPU使用情况,可以使用`ps` 和 `pgrep` 命令配合。
阅读全文